People are out here spending millions on basic weddings incorporating things that are not really necessary simply because they're following the customary wedding rule books.

While some brides and grooms want a show stopping wedding full of glitz and glamour, increasingly, we are seeing another section of brides and grooms going for simple elegance weddings.

After all, a wedding is basically a small ceremony for your loved ones to witness your union and celebrate with you so you don't need all the pizzazz sometimes.

Did y'all see the simple dress that Esther Kazungu wore when she was getting married? There's no need to spend hundreds of thousands on a dress you will wear once. Instead, go for a simple but stunning tailor made gown or rent one from rent-a-dress stores. You could also go for something borrowed, say a dress that your mother or grandma wore and customize it a little to get the perfect finish and fit.
